[Webkit-unassigned] [Bug 13150] Character entity references should produce same result as numeric

bugzilla-daemon at webkit.org bugzilla-daemon at webkit.org
Sat Mar 24 01:00:23 PDT 2007


http://bugs.webkit.org/show_bug.cgi?id=13150





------- Comment #14 from ap at webkit.org  2007-03-24 01:00 PDT -------
Talking about characters with singleton decompositions being deprecated, I
agree that there is no formal official provision saying this. However, that
fact that such characters can not appear in any normalized text speaks for
itself. See, for example, the definition of "singleton decomposition" at
<http://safari.oreilly.com/0201700522/idd1e35240>.

I am not completely sure what you are suggesting for this bug. Should we return
to the HTML mapping for ⟩ and ⟨? Then they won't render with default
OS X fonts, and any text using them would become denormalized. Neither is a
positive outcome. And one can even argue that we do not violate the HTML spec
by changing the mapping, see <http://www.unicode.org/faq/char_combmark.html#8>.
So, I do not think that we are going to change this back.

Your comment has some interesting ideas about in-memory processing. It would be
really great if you could verify those against
<http://www.w3.org/TR/charmod-norm/>, and file separate bugs (preferably with
tests) for cases where we do not conform.


-- 
Configure bugmail: http://bugs.webkit.org/userprefs.cgi?tab=email
------- You are receiving this mail because: -------
You are the assignee for the bug, or are watching the assignee.



More information about the webkit-unassigned mailing list